Day-to-Day Responsibilities
Develop project specifications with internal and external partners
Execute electrical design studies for process utilities and facility capacity
Oversee development of detailed electrical design packages
Coordinate with multiple external engineering partners
Track and manage procurement of electrical materials and equipment
Manage full construction lifecycle, including:
Project cost and schedule estimates
Final design
Bidding and contractor selection
Contract and change management
Installation, commissioning, and start-up
Ensure final project documentation and closeout in an industrial plant environment
Assist with coordination of non-electrical trades (mechanical, civil, etc.) as needed
Required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ent technical experience
Strong communication and cross-functional collaboration skills
Working knowledge of electrical design standards
Experience With NEC Regulations And NFPA 70E Requirements
Project management or project coordination experience in industrial manufacturing or commercial construction environments
